HOW ALCOHOL CAUSES MENTAL AND MORAL CHANGES.

HOW ALCOHOL CAUSES MENTAL AND MORAL CHANGES.

The transforming power or alcohol is marvelous, and often appalling. It seems to open a way of entrance into the soul for all classes of foolish, insane or malignant spirits, who, so long as it remains in contact with the brain, are able to hold possession. Men of the kindest nature when sober, act often like fiends when drunk. Crimes and outrages are committed, which shock and shame the perpetrators when the excitement of inebriation has passed away. Referring to this subject, Dr. Henry Munroe says:

"It appears from the experience of Mr. Fletcher, who has paid much attention to the cases of drunkards, from the remarks of Mr. Dunn, in his 'Medical Psychology,' and from observations of my own, that there is some analogy between our physical and psychical natures; for, as the physical part of us, when its power is at a low ebb, becomes susceptible of morbid influences which, in full vigor, would pass over it without effect, so when the psychical (synonymous with the  moral ) part of the brain has its healthy function disturbed and deranged by the introduction of a morbid poison like alcohol, the individual so circumstanced sinks in depravity, and "becomes the helpless subject of the forces of evil, "which are powerless against a nature free from the morbid influences of alcohol."

Different persons are affected in different ways by the same poison. Indulgence in alcoholic drinks may act upon one or more of the cerebral organs; and, as its necessary consequence, the manifestations of functional disturbance will follow in such of the mental powers as these organs subserve. If the indulgence be continued, then, either from deranged nutrition or organic lesion, manifestations formerly developed only during a fit of intoxication may become  permanent , and terminate in insanity or dypso-mania. M. Flourens first pointed out the fact that certain morbific agents, when introduced into the current of the circulation, tend to act  primarily  and  specially  on one nervous centre in preference to that of another, by virtue of some special elective affinity between such morbific agents and certain ganglia. Thus, in the tottering gait of the tipsy man, we see the influence of alcohol upon the functions of the  cerebellum  in the impairment of its power of co-ordinating the muscles.

Certain writers on diseases of the mind make especial allusion to that form of insanity termed 'dypsomania', in which a person has an unquenchable thirst for alcoholic drinks a tendency as decidedly maniacal as that of  homicidal mania ; or the uncontrollable desire to burn, termed  pyromania ; or to steal, called  kleptomania.

Homicidal mania.
---------------

The different tendencies of homicidal mania in different individuals are often only nursed into action when the current of the blood has been poisoned with alcohol. I had a case of a person who, whenever his brain was so excited, told me that he experienced a most uncontrollable desire to kill or injure some one; so much so, that he could at times hardly restrain himself from the action, and was obliged to refrain from all stimulants, lest, in an unlucky moment, he might commit himself. Townley, who murdered the young lady of his affections, for which he was sentenced to be imprisoned in a lunatic asylum for life,  poisoned his brain with brandy  and soda-water before he committed the rash act. The brandy stimulated into action certain portions of the brain, which acquired such a power as to subjugate his will, and hurry him to the performance of a frightful deed, opposed alike to his better judgment and his ordinary desires.

As to pyromania , some years ago I knew a laboring man in a country village, who, whenever he had had a few glasses of ale at the public-house, would chuckle with delight at the thought of firing certain gentlemen's stacks. Yet, when his brain was free from the poison, a quieter, better-disposed man could not be. Unfortunately, he became addicted to habits of intoxication; and, one night, under alcoholic excitement, fired some stacks belonging to his employers, for which, he was sentenced for fifteen years to a penal settlement, where his brain would never again be alcoholically excited.

Kleptomania.
-----------

Next, I will give an example of  kleptomania . I knew, many years ago, a very clever, industrious and talented young man, who told me that whenever he had been drinking, he could hardly withstand, the temptation of stealing anything that came in his way; but that these feelings never troubled him at other times. One afternoon, after he had been indulging with his fellow-workmen in drink, his will, unfortunately, was overpowered, and he took from the mansion where he was working some articles of worth, for which he was accused, and afterwards sentenced to a term of imprisonment. When set at liberty he had the good fortune to be placed among some kind-hearted persons, vulgarly called teetotallers ; and, from conscientious motives, signed the PLEDGE, now above twenty years ago. From that time to the present moment he has never experienced the overmastering desire which so often beset him in his drinking days to take that which was not his own. Moreover, no pretext on earth could now entice him to taste of any liquor containing alcohol, feeling that, under its influence, he might again fall its victim. He holds an influential position in the town where he resides.

I have known some ladies of good position in society, who, after a dinner or supper-party, and after having taken sundry glasses of wine, could not withstand the temptation of taking home any little article not their own, when the opportunity offered; and who, in their sober moments, have returned them, as if taken by mistake. We have many instances recorded in our police reports of gentlemen of position, under the influence of drink, committing thefts of the most paltry articles, afterwards returned to the owners by their friends, which can only be accounted for, psychologically, by the fact that the  will  had been for the time completely overpowered by the subtle influence of alcohol.

Loss of mental clearness.
------------------------

Alcohol, whether taken in large or small doses, immediately disturbs the natural functions of the mind and body, is now conceded by the most eminent physiologists. Dr. Brinton says: 'Mental acuteness, accuracy of conception, and delicacy of the senses, are all so far opposed by the action of alcohol, as that the maximum efforts of each are  incompatible  with the ingestion of any moderate quantity of fermented liquid. Indeed, there is scarcely any calling which demands skillful and exact effort of mind and body, or which requires the balanced exercise of many faculties, that does not illustrate this rule. The mathematician, the gambler, the metaphysician, the billiard-player, the author, the artist, the physician, would, if they could analyze their experience aright, generally concur in the statement, that  a single glass will often suffice to take , so to speak,  the edge off both mind and body , and to reduce their capacity to something below what is relatively their perfection of work.

A train was driven carelessly into one of the principal London stations, running into another train, killing, by the collision, six or seven persons, and injuring many others. From the evidence at the inquest, it appeared that the guard was reckoned sober, only he had had two glasses of ale with a friend at a previous station. Now, reasoning psychologically, these two glasses of ale had probably been instrumental in  taking off the edge  from his perceptions and prudence, and producing a carelessness or boldness of action which would not have occurred under the cooling, temperate influence of a beverage free from alcohol. Many persons have admitted to me that they were not the same after taking even one glass of ale or wine that they were before, and could not  thoroughly  trust themselves after they had taken this single glass.

Impairment of memory.
---------------------

An impairment of the memory is among the early symptoms of alcoholic derangement.

"This," says Dr. Richardson, "extends even to forgetfulness of the commonest things; to names of familiar persons, to dates, to duties of daily life. Strangely, too," he adds, "this failure, like that which indicates, in the aged, the era of second childishness and mere oblivion, does not extend to the things of the past, but is confined to events that are passing. On old memories the mind retains its power; on new ones it requires constant prompting and sustainment."

Food poisoning is an acute gastroenteritis caused by the consumption of a food material or a drink which contains the pathogenic micro organism or their toxins or poisonous chemicals.Food poisoning is common in hostels,hotels,communal feedings, and festivel seasons.

A group of persons will be affected with same type of symptoms ,and they give a history of consumption of a common food before few hours.

Types of food poisoning

1) Bacterial food poisoning:

Here the micro organisms called bacteria are responsible.The food material may contain the pathogenic bacteriae or their toxin and will be ingested along with the food.

2) Non bacterial food poisoning:

Due to the presence of toxic chemicals like fertilizers,insectisides,heavy metals and ect.

Since bacterial food poisoning is common it is discussed here.

Bacterial food poisoning:

All bacteria are not harmful.There are some pathogenic bacteria which secrete toxins and cause clinical manifestations.These organisms enter the human body through food articles or drinks.

How food poisoning occures:

1) Presence of bacteria in the water.

2) The raw materials for the food may contain toxins.

3) Premises where the food is prepared may contain micro organisms or toxins.

4) Food handlers may have some infectious diseases.

5) Some animals like dogs,rats may contaminate the food.

6) If prepared food is kept in the room temperature for a long time and heated again can make a chance for food poisoning.

7) Purposely some body mixing toxins in the food.


Some common bacterial food poisonings.

1) Salmonella food poisoning:

There are three different varieties of salmonella bacteria.(salmonella typhimurium,salmonella cholera suis,salmonella enteritidis) These bacteria are present in milk, milk products and eggs.  Symptoms of this food poisoning include nausea, vomiting and diarrhoea.  Fever is also common.

2) Botulism:

This is the dangerous type of food poisoning caused by clostridium botulinum.   The spores of these organisms are seen in the soil and enters the human body through pickles and canned fish ect.Compared to other food poisonings here vomiting and diarrhoea are rare Mainly the nervous system is affected.The symptoms starts with double vision,numbness with weakness.Later there will be paralysis with cardiac and respiratory failure ending in death.

3) Staphylococcal food poisoning:

It is caused by staphylo coccus aureus. These organisms usually cause skin troubles like boils and eruptions.It causes mastitis in cow.Through the milk and milk products it enders and causes gastroenteritis.There will be vomiting,abdominal cramps with diarrhoea.

4) Closteridium food poisoning:

This is caused by closteridium perfringens.They are present in stool,soil and water. They enter the body through,meat,meat dishes and egg ect.If food articles are cooked and kept in room temperature for a long time and heated again before eating can result this food poisoning.Symptoms include vomiting ,diarrhoea and abdominal cramps.

5) Bacillus cereus:

The spores of these organisms can survive cooking and causes enteritis.  Diarrhoea and vomiting is common in this infection.


How to investigate food poisoning?

1) Examine each and every person affected.

2) Water sample should be tested.

3) Kitchen, store room and food samples should be examined.

4) The cook and food handlers should be questioned and examined.

5) Samples of vomitus and stool of all victims should be tested to identify the bacteria.


How to prevent food poisoning:-

1) Only purified water should be used.

2) Hygiene should be maintained by all persons keeping contact with food.

3) Workers should use masks, cap and gloves during cooking and serving.

4) Sick individuals should not come in contact with food materials.

5) Kitchen and premises should be neat and clean.

5) Vessels should be washed with soap and hot water.

6) Should not keep the prepared food for a long time in room temperature.

7) All food materials should be kept in closed containers.

8) Animals like dog, cat, rat ect should not come in contact with food materials.

9) Vegetables should be washed before cooking.

10) Meat should be fresh and should be purchased from recognised slaughter house.

Dr. Richardson, in his lectures on alcohol, given both in England and America, speaking of the action of this substance on the blood after passing from the stomach, says:

"Suppose, then, a certain measure of alcohol be taken into the stomach, it will be absorbed there, but, previous to absorption, it will have to undergo a proper degree of dilution with water, for there is this peculiarity respecting alcohol when it is separated by an animal membrane from a watery fluid like the blood, that it will not pass through the membrane until it has become charged, to a given point of dilution, with water. It is itself, in fact,  so greedy for water, it will pick it up from watery textures, and deprive them of it until, by its saturation, its power of reception is exhausted , after which it will diffuse into the current of circulating fluid."

It is this power of absorbing water from every texture with which alcoholic spirits comes in contact, that creates the burning thirst of those who freely indulge in its use. Its effect, when it reaches the circulation, is thus described by Dr. Richardson:

"As it passes through the circulation of the lungs it is exposed to the air, and some little of it, raised into vapor by the natural heat, is thrown off in expiration. If the quantity of it be large, this loss may be considerable, and the odor of the spirit may be detected in the expired breath. If the quantity be small, the loss will be comparatively little, as the spirit will be held in solution by the water in the blood. After it has passed through the lungs, and has been driven by the left heart over the arterial circuit, it passes into what is called the minute circulation, or the structural circulation of the organism. The arteries here extend into very small vessels, which are called arterioles, and from these infinitely small vessels spring the equally minute radicals or roots of the veins, which are ultimately to become the great rivers bearing the blood back to the heart. In its passage through this minute circulation the alcohol finds its way to every organ. To this brain, to these muscles, to these secreting or excreting organs, nay, even into this bony structure itself, it moves with the blood. In some of these parts which are not excreting, it remains for a time diffused, and in those parts where there is a large percentage of water, it remains longer than in other parts. From some organs which have an open tube for conveying fluids away, as the liver and kidneys, it is thrown out or eliminated, and in this way a portion of it is ultimately removed from the body. The rest passing round and round with the circulation, is probably decomposed and carried off in new forms of matter.

"When we know the course which the alcohol takes in its passage through the body, from the period of its absorption to that of its elimination, we are the better able to judge what physical changes it induces in the different organs and structures with which it comes in contact. It first reaches the blood; but, as a rule, the quantity of it that enters is insufficient to produce any material effect on that fluid. If, however, the dose taken be poisonous or semi-poisonous, then even the blood, rich as it is in water and it contains seven hundred and ninety parts in a thousand is affected. The alcohol is diffused through this water, and there it comes in contact with the other constituent parts, with the fibrine, that plastic substance which, when blood is drawn, clots and coagulates, and which is present in the proportion of from two to three parts in a thousand; with the albumen which exists in the proportion of seventy parts; with the salts which yield about ten parts; with the fatty matters; and lastly, with those minute, round bodies which float in myriads in the blood (which were discovered by the Dutch philosopher, Leuwenhock, as one of the first results of microscopical observation, about the middle of the seventeenth century), and which are called the blood globules or corpuscles. These last-named bodies are, in fact, cells; their discs, when natural, have a smooth outline, they are depressed in the centre, and they are red in color; the color of the blood being derived from them. We have discovered that there exist other corpuscles or cells in the blood in much smaller quantity, which are called white cells, and these different cells float in the blood-stream within the vessels. The red take the centre of the stream; the white lie externally near the sides of the vessels, moving less quickly. Our business is mainly with the red corpuscles. They perform the most important functions in the economy; they absorb, in great part, the oxygen which we inhale in breathing, and carry it to the extreme tissues of the body; they absorb, in great part, the carbonic acid gas which is produced in the combustion of the body in the extreme tissues, and bring that gas back to the lungs to be exchanged for oxygen there; in short, they are the vital instruments of the circulation.

"With all these parts of the blood, with the water, fibrine, albumen, salts, fatty matter and corpuscles, the alcohol comes in contact when it enters the blood, and, if it be in sufficient quantity, it produces disturbing action. I have watched this disturbance very carefully on the blood corpuscles; for, in some animals we can see these floating along during life, and we can also observe them from men who are under the effects of alcohol, by removing a speck of blood, and examining it with the microscope. The action of the alcohol, when it is observable, is varied. It may cause the corpuscles to run too closely together, and to adhere in rolls; it may modify their outline, making the clear-defined, smooth, outer edge irregular or crenate, or even starlike; it may change the round corpuscle into the oval form, or, in very extreme cases, it may produce what I may call a truncated form of corpuscles, in which the change is so great that if we did not trace it through all its stages, we should be puzzled to know whether the object looked at were indeed a blood-cell. All these changes are due to the action of the spirit upon the water contained in the corpuscles; upon the capacity of the spirit to extract water from them. During every stage of modification of corpuscles thus described, their function to absorb and fix gases is impaired, and when the aggregation of the cells, in masses, is great, other difficulties arise, for the cells, united together, pass less easily than they should through the minute vessels of the lungs and of the general circulation, and impede the current, by which local injury is produced.

"A further action upon the blood, instituted by alcohol in excess, is upon the fibrine or the plastic colloidal matter. On this the spirit may act in two different ways, according to the degree in which it affects the water that holds the fibrine in solution. It may fix the water with the fibrine, and thus destroy the power of coagulation; or it may extract the water so determinately as to produce coagulation."

Bad breath is a common health problem in the society.Offenssive smell from the mouth may be due to various reasons.The main reason is the presence of anaerobic bacteria in the biofilm formed on the tongue .These bacteria degrades the proteins present in the food resulting in the production of some offenssive gases like hydrogen sulphide,skatol ect.

Bad odor from the mouth in the early morning is seen in almost all individuals.This can be controlled by maintaining oral hygiene.Even after cleaning the mouth some individuals may suffer from bad breath due to some problem in the mouth or in the nearby areas.Some general disease condition can also produce bad breath.Exact cause has to be identified and should be treated accordingly.Some common measures to cure or reduce bad breath are discussed here.

1) Oral hygiene:

Mouth should be kept clean every time to reduce the bacterial action.After food gargling with lukewarm water is very essential.Even after small food articles like snacks,sweets,buscuits cleaning with water is needed.Brushing should be done twice daily.It is said that early morning brushing is for beauty and bed time brushing is for good health.

2) Brushing techniques:

Normal brushing technique should be followed for better result.Many people brush vigorously causing damage to the gums.Brushing after every food and drink can damage the enamel .Bristles of the tooth brush should be smooth but hard enough to remove the food particles from the gaps.The direction of brushing is the most important thing.The upper teeth should be brushed in a downward direction and the lower in upward direction.This is applicable to both inner and outer surfaces.Next comes the crown of the teeth;here brushing is done in anterior and posterior direction keeping the brush in same direction.This applicable to both upper and lower set of teeth.

3) Tongue cleaning:

White or yellowish coating on the tongue can cause bad breath.This is more well marked in the morning and should be removed twice daily with the healp of a tongue cleaner.  Tongue cleaner must be used gently without damaging the taste buds on the tongue.

4) Tooth pick:

Tooth pick is a small strip of wood or plastic with a pointed end.This is used to remove food particles lodged between the gaps.Very useful after eating meat and fish.Should be used gently to avoid damage to gums.

5) Gargling:

After every meal gargling with lukewarm water is useful.For better result little common salt is dissolved in the lukewarm water .Different types of mouth wash is available in the market in different trade names.Gargling with mouth wash can also reduce bad breath.

6) Food habits:

Protein containing food articles are known to produce bad breath.  Example; meat, milk, fish, egg etc.  If these food articles are taken proper cleaning is essential.Some food articles are known to produce particular smell which may be unpleasent for others.  Raw onion is the best example.It is said that an apple a day keeps the doctor away and a raw onion a day keep every body away.Small food articles taken in between can also cause bad smell(nuts,fried items etc).Maintaining regularity in food timing is the most important thing.

7) Water intake:

Dryness in the mouth can make a favourable condition for the bacterial activity resulting in bad odor.saliva is needed to keep the mouth moist and to reduce the bacterial proliferation.Production of saliva is closely related with water balance of the body and hence sufficient quantity of water should be taken to maintain the production of saliva.

8) Mouth freshners:

Natural and artificial mouth freshners can reduce the intensity of bad breath to some extent.Spicy articles are commonly used for this purpose.Chewing spices like clove,cumin seed,cardomom,cinnamon,ginger ect are useful. All citrus fruits can reduce bad odor.Mouth freshners and chewing gums are available in the market.these products are also helpful ,but some may cause damage hence should be used with caution.

The nails are present at the end of each finger tip on the dorsal surface.The main function of nail is protection and it also helps for a firm grip for holding articles.It consists of a strong relatively flexible keratinous nail plate originating from the nail matrix. Under the nail plate there is a soft tissue called nail bed.Between the skin and nail plate there is a nail fold or cuticle.Normal healthy nail is slight pink in colour and the surface is convex from side to side.Finger nails grow 1 cm in three months and toe nails take 24 months for the same.

Importance of nails in disease diagnosis:

The colour ,appearance,shape and nature of the nails give some information about the general health and hygiene of a person . Nails are examined as a routine by all doctors to get some clues about underlying diseases.Just looking at nails we can makeout the hygiene of a person.The abnormal nail may be congenital or due to some diseases.The cause for changes in the nail extend from simple reasons to life threatening diseases.Hence the examination by a doctor is essential for diagnosis .Some abnormal findings with probable causes are discussed here for general awareness.

1) Hygiene:-

We can make out an unhygienic nail very easily .Deposition of dirt under the distal end of nail plate can make a chance for ingestion of pathogens while eating.If nail cutting is not done properly it can result in worm troubles in children.When the worms crawl in the anal orifice children will scratch which lodges the ova of worms under the nails and will be taken in while eating.Prominent nail can also complicate a skin disease by habitual scratching.Sharp nails in small kids cause small wounds when they do feet kicking or hand waving.

2) Colour of the nails:-

a) Nails become pale in anaemia.

b) Opaque white discolouration(leuconychia) is seen in chronic renal failure and nephrotic syndrome.

c) Whitening is also seen in hypoalbuminaemia as in cirrhosis and kidney disorders.
                              
d) Drugs like sulpha group,anti malarial and antibiotics ect can produce discolouration in the nails.
                       
e) Fungal infection causes black discolouration.

f) In pseudomonas infection nails become black or green.

g) Nail bed infarction occures in vasculitis especially in SLE and polyarteritis.

h) Red dots are seen in nails due to splinter haemorrhages in subacute bacterial endo carditis, rheumatoid arthritis, trauma, collagen vascular diseases.

i) Blunt injury produces haemorrhage and causes blue/black discolouration.

j) Nails become brown in kidney diseases and in decreased adrenal activity.

k) In wilsons disease blue colour in semicircle appears in the nail.

l) When the blood supply decreases nail become yellow .In jaundice and psoriasis also nail become yellowish.

m) In yellow nail syndrome all nails become yellowish with pleural effusion.

3) Shape of nails:-

a) Clubbing: Here tissues at the base of nails are thickened and the angle between the nail base and the skin is obliterated. The nail becomes more convex and the finger tip becomes bulbous and looks like an end of a drumstick. When the condition becomes worse the nail looks like a parrot beak.

Causes of clubbing:-

Congenital Injuries

Severe chronic cyanosis

Lung diseases like empyema,bronchiactesis,carcinoma of bronchus and pulmonary tuberculosis.
Abdominal diseases like crohn's disease,polyposis of colon,ulcerative colitis,liver cirrhosis ect...

Heart diseases like fallot's tetralogy,subacute bacterial endocarditis and ect..
             
b) Koilonychia:-

Here the nails become concave like a spoon.This condition is seen in iron deficiency anaemia.In this condition the nails become thin,soft and brittle.The normal convexity will be replaced by concavity.

c) Longitudinal ridging is seen in raynaud's disease.

d) Cuticle becomes ragged in dermatomyositis.

e) Nail fold telangiectasia is a sign in dermatomyositis ,systemic sclerosis and SLE.

4) Structure and consistancy:-

a) Fungal infection of nail causes discolouration,deformity,hypertrophy and abnormal brittleness.

b) Thimble pitting of nail is charecteristic of psoriasis ,acute eczema and alopecia aereata.
  
c) The inflamation of cuticle or nail fold is called paronychia.

d) Onycholysis is the seperation of nail bed seen in psoriasis,infection and after taking tetracyclines.

e) Destruction of nail is seen in lichen planus,epidermolysis bullosa.

f) Missing nail is seen in nail patella syndrome.It is a hereditary disease.

g) Nails become brittle in raynauds disease and gangrene.

h) Falling of nail is seen in fungal infection,psoriasis and thyroid diseases.

5) Growth:-

Reduction in blood supply affects the growth of nails. Nail growth is also affected in severe ilness. when the disease disappears the growth starts again resulting in formation of transverse ridges.These lines are called Beau's lines and are healpful to date the onset of illness.

The parts which first suffer from alcohol are those expansions of the body which the anatomists call the membranes. "The skin is a membranous envelope. Through the whole of the alimentary surface, from the lips downward, and through the bronchial passages to their minutest ramifications, extends the mucous membrane. The lungs, the heart, the liver, the kidneys are folded in delicate membranes, which can be stripped easily from these parts. If you take a portion of bone, you will find it easy to strip off from it a membranous sheath or covering; if you examine a joint, you will find both the head and the socket lined with membranes. The whole of the intestines are enveloped in a fine membrane called  peritoneum . All the muscles are enveloped in membranes, and the fasciculi, or bundles and fibres of muscles, have their membranous sheathing. The brain and spinal cord are enveloped in three membranes; one nearest to themselves, a pure vascular structure, a network of blood-vessels; another, a thin serous structure; a third, a strong fibrous structure. The eyeball is a structure of colloidal humors and membranes, and of nothing else. To complete the description, the minute structures of the vital organs are enrolled in membranous matter."

These membranes are the filters of the body. "In their absence there could be no building of structure, no solidification of tissue, nor organic mechanism. Passive themselves, they, nevertheless, separate all structures into their respective positions and adaptations."

Membranous deteriorations.
-------------------------

In order to make perfectly clear to your mind the action and use of these membranous expansions, and the way in which alcohol deteriorates them, and obstructs their work, we quote again from Dr. Richardson:

"The animal receives from the vegetable world and from the earth the food and drink it requires for its sustenance and motion. It receives colloidal food for its muscles: combustible food for its motion; water for the solution of its various parts; salt for constructive and other physical purposes. These have all to be arranged in the body; and they are arranged by means of the membranous envelopes. Through these membranes nothing can pass that is not, for the time, in a state of aqueous solution, like water or soluble salts. Water passes freely through them, salts pass freely through them, but the constructive matter of the active parts that is colloidal does not pass; it is retained in them until it is chemically decomposed into the soluble type of matter. When we take for our food a portion of animal flesh, it is first resolved, in digestion, into a soluble fluid before it can be absorbed; in the blood it is resolved into the fluid colloidal condition; in the solids it is laid down within the membranes into new structure, and when it has played its part, it is digested again, if I may so say, into a crystalloidal soluble substance, ready to be carried away and replaced by addition of new matter, then it is dialysed or passed through, the membranes into the blood, and is disposed of in the excretions.

"See, then, what an all-important part these membranous structures play in the animal life. Upon their integrity all the silent work of the building up of the body depends. If these membranes are rendered too porous, and let out the colloidal fluids of the blood the albumen, for example the body so circumstanced, dies; dies as if it were slowly bled to death. If, on the contrary, they become condensed or thickened, or loaded with foreign material, then they fail to allow the natural fluids to pass through them. They fail to dialyse, and the result is, either an accumulation of the fluid in a closed cavity, or contraction of the substance inclosed within the membrane, or dryness of membrane in surfaces that ought to be freely lubricated and kept apart. In old age we see the effects of modification of membrane naturally induced; we see the fixed joint, the shrunken and feeble muscle, the dimmed eye, the deaf ear, the enfeebled nervous function.

"It may possibly seem, at first sight, that I am leading immediately away from the subject of the secondary action of alcohol. It is not so. I am leading directly to it. Upon all these membranous structures alcohol exerts a direct perversion of action. It produces in them a thickening, a shrinking and an inactivity that reduces their functional power. That they may work rapidly and equally, they require to be at all times charged with water to saturation. If, into contact with them, any agent is brought that deprives them of water, then is their work interfered with; they cease to separate the saline constituents properly; and, if the evil that is thus started, be allowed to continue, they contract upon their contained matter in whatever organ it may be situated, and condense it.

"In brief, under the prolonged influence of alcohol those changes which take place from it in the blood corpuscles, extend to the other organic parts, involving them in structural deteriorations, which are always dangerous, and are often ultimately fatal."
